Citrus County, FL - A Florida woman is facing homicide charges after investigators say she allegedly shot and killed two of her former husbands in separate counties within hours of each other.
Authorities identified the suspect as 51 year old Susan Erica Avalon of Citrus County.
According to law enforcement, the first shooting occurred Wednesday afternoon at a home in Bradenton.
Deputies with the Manatee County Sheriff’s Office responded to reports of a man suffering from gunshot wounds.
The victim was transported to a hospital, where he later died. Investigators say the man identified his ex wife as a possible suspect before his death.
Detectives allege Avalon used a food delivery order to get the victim to open his front door before shooting him.
A teenage child was inside the home at the time but did not witness the shooting.
License plate readers later tracked a vehicle believed to be involved back to Avalon’s Citrus County residence.
When deputies contacted Avalon at her home, they reported observing her cleaning the vehicle with bleach.
During questioning, investigators say Avalon made a statement that raised concerns about another possible victim.
This prompted authorities to contact the Tampa Police Department to conduct a welfare check at a residence in Hillsborough County.
Officers in Tampa discovered a second man deceased inside a home with multiple gunshot wounds.
Police confirmed the man was also a former husband of Avalon.
The death is being investigated as a related homicide, though additional charges have not yet been announced.
Avalon was arrested and charged with second degree murder in the Bradenton case.
Prosecutors have indicated the case will be presented to a grand jury, and additional charges are possible as investigations continue across jurisdictions.
She remains in custody without bond.
